是使用SimpleDateFormat类进行格式化。以下是一个示例代码:
import java.sql.Date;
import java.text.SimpleDateFormat;
public class DateConversion {
public static void main(String[] args) {
// 原始日期字符串
String dateString = "2022-01-01";
// 将字符串转换为java.sql.Date对象
Date date = Date.valueOf(dateString);
// 定义目标日期格式
SimpleDateFormat targetFormat = new SimpleDateFormat("dd MMMM yyyy");
// 使用目标日期格式将java.sql.Date对象转换为字符串
String formattedDate = targetFormat.format(date);
System.out.println(formattedDate);
}
}
这段代码将字符串"2022-01-01"转换为"01 January 2022"格式的日期字符串。首先,使用Date.valueOf()
方法将字符串转换为java.sql.Date
对象。然后,创建一个SimpleDateFormat
对象,并指定目标日期格式为"dd MMMM yyyy"。最后,使用format()
方法将java.sql.Date
对象转换为目标格式的字符串。
这种方法的优势是简单易懂,适用于大多数情况下的日期格式转换。它可以灵活地根据需求定义不同的日期格式,并且可以处理不同的语言环境。
在腾讯云的产品中,与日期处理相关的产品包括云数据库MySQL、云数据库MariaDB、云数据库PostgreSQL等。这些产品提供了强大的数据库功能,可以存储和处理日期数据。您可以根据具体需求选择适合的产品。以下是腾讯云产品的链接地址:
请注意,这里只是提供了腾讯云的一些产品作为参考,您可以根据实际需求选择适合的云计算产品。
领取专属 10元无门槛券
手把手带您无忧上云